Occasionally when I click on a link in my browser(both Netscape 7 and Explorer 6), I get a red block in the location bar with the text, "service.bfast....etc.etc." Along with this I get a white (blank) browser screen with the blue frame at very top showing "gif image 1 x 1 pixel." What is the cause of this? I have done a virus and spyware scan but all seems OK there. Thanks.

What you're seeing is an affiliate link, I believe from Linkshare (someone correct me if I'm wrong). They include the 1x1 GIF as part of the link tracking -- so it's not spyware or anything. Unfortunately, it also causes the browser to hang on occasion ....

<added>On reading your description more closely, it looks like the site owner may not be setting up the affiliate link correctly, causing it to load the 1x1 GIF instead of going to the site it should.

Thanks. I think I got it solved. I have an ad server manager program supplied by my internet service provider. I noticed it had "bfast" blocked so I deleted it as being blocked. Now the link works fine. Another work around is to just disable the ad manager. The software is called "Freedom."
